The Genesee County Board of Commissioners held a workshop meeting on June 3, 2026, focusing primarily on senior services and the county's budget outlook. The senior services task force presented a comprehensive report with recommendations, including increasing millage funding, enhancing marketing efforts, and providing case managers to address waitlists at senior centers. The task force emphasized the need for improved collaboration among service providers and highlighted funding challenges, including the discontinuation of the ramp program due to cost and contractor issues. The board discussed the importance of these recommendations in the context of the upcoming budget season. The second half of the meeting featured a detailed budget update presented by the county's CFO, outlining revenue projections, expenditure pressures, and legacy costs such as pensions and healthcare. The commissioners reviewed potential impacts of state tax reforms, federal funding changes, and capital needs, noting the necessity for difficult budget decisions. The meeting concluded with scheduling of upcoming budget hearings and a commitment to ongoing fiscal monitoring.
